Abstract:
This reaserch was carried out for controlling and enhancement the flux of water from the GVHP membrane in osmotic concentration (OC) for mixture of Glycerol and water (wt50% -wt99%). At constant operating conditions of time and stirring, the influence of temperature and feed concentration on Glycerol dehydration by osmotic concentration will be discussed in this study. The operating temperature was changed between 20 o C and 60 o C. The obtained results were analyzed using MultiSimplex Lite software. By this software influence of temperature and feed concentration (concentration of initially mixture) on the flux of water was studied and optimum conditions were obtained. The optimum condition for highest mass flux was 44 ° C using a solvent containing 45% Glycerol. From these results was found that permeation characteristics are obviously depend on the feed concentration and temperature. Results showed that increasing in mass flux is obtained by increasing the water fractional pressure in feed side. The permeation rate significantly increases and the selectivity decreases with increasing the temperature.
